Description

The Department of Defense, specifically the Department of the Navy through NAVSUP Weapon Systems Support MECH, is soliciting proposals for the assembly of circuit cards. This procurement aims to secure services related to the manufacturing of bare printed circuit boards, which are critical components in various electronic systems used by the Navy. The selected contractor will be responsible for providing electrical and electronic assemblies, boards, cards, and associated hardware, which play a vital role in ensuring the operational readiness of naval equipment.
